A few years past http://www.greengathering2012.co.uk/, thinking of purchasing LED light bulbs for the house was rather unrealistic for most folks. We were only becoming used to the thought of changing our traditional incandescent lightbulbs with the new compact fluorescent lamps (CFLs) that cost more up-front but last a lot longer. LED light bulbs were some thing we used to see in fancy restaurants, shops and clubs, but these were simply too pricey for the ordinary individual to use at home.
Thanks to recent technical progress, yet, light-emitting diodes now are considerably cheaper, and at once there are more strong LED lightbulb versions out there. These new lights items have become increasingly accessible to everyone, and are not only to be discovered in specialty shops. Nowadays, you can purchase a lightbulb composed of a bunch of light-emitting diodes that ties in a normal mild fitting, therefore you won't need to purchase new lamps so that you can reap the benefits of this fascinating new technology.
Even Though it is going to set you back more than the usual compact fluorescent lamp or a conventional light bulb, an LED bulb is more energy-effective because it emits more light per watt of power used up. It's going to thus continue you more and need less electricity to operate, leading to substantial cost savings over time. An average LED lamp for home use has a planned lifespan of 30,000 hrs, or 20-30 years with regular use (three to four hrs a day), while a compact fluorescent is anticipated to continue around 8,000 hrs and an incandescent lightbulb only 1,000 hours.
Even Though costs came down significantly, a branded led-light bulb will still cost you $30-50 these times. Shifting your entire national light to light-emitting diodes can need quite an expense, to put it differently. However you can find more affordable options if you look around.
